SwiftUI: The Future of UI Development

Let's get even deeper into SwiftUI! This framework is rad, and it's quickly becoming the go-to choice for iOS developers looking to build modern, responsive, and cross-platform user interfaces. SwiftUI offers a declarative approach to UI development, which means that developers describe what they want their UI to look like, and the framework takes care of the implementation details. This approach simplifies the development process, making it faster and easier to create complex UIs. One of the greatest benefits of SwiftUI is its ease of use. The syntax is clean, concise, and easy to learn. Developers can quickly create user interfaces with less code, reducing the chances of errors and improving the overall development efficiency. Moreover, SwiftUI has excellent cross-platform support. You can write your UI code once and have it run on multiple Apple platforms, including iOS, iPadOS, macOS, tvOS, and watchOS. This makes it a great choice for developers who want to target multiple platforms. SwiftUI is also designed to be highly dynamic, providing automatic updates when data changes. This means that when the data driving your UI changes, the UI updates automatically to reflect the new state, ensuring that the user always has an up-to-date view of the information. Finally, SwiftUI has built-in support for accessibility, which is important for creating apps that are usable by everyone. SwiftUI automatically handles many accessibility features, such as screen reader support and dynamic type, which helps developers create apps that are inclusive and meet accessibility standards. SwiftUI is constantly evolving and improving, making it an exciting technology for iOS developers to embrace. With its ease of use, cross-platform capabilities, and dynamic updates, SwiftUI is revolutionizing UI development on Apple platforms.

ARKit: Creating Immersive Experiences

Alright, let's explore ARKit a bit more! ARKit is amazing, providing developers with the tools to create incredibly immersive augmented reality experiences. With ARKit, you can integrate digital content seamlessly into the real world, creating experiences that blur the lines between reality and virtuality. One of the key capabilities of ARKit is its ability to track real-world objects. ARKit uses the device's camera and sensors to detect and track objects in the user's environment. This allows developers to create AR experiences that react to the real world, such as placing virtual furniture in a room or adding virtual characters to a scene. Another important feature of ARKit is surface detection. ARKit can detect surfaces, such as floors, tables, and walls, and allows developers to place virtual objects on those surfaces. This allows for more realistic AR experiences, as virtual objects appear to interact with the environment. ARKit is also capable of world tracking, which means that it can track the device's position and orientation in the real world. This allows developers to create AR experiences that are persistent and can be viewed from different angles. With the latest updates, ARKit has improved object recognition and tracking, allowing for more realistic and interactive experiences. With ARKit, developers can create a wide range of AR experiences, from games and educational apps to shopping and design tools. ARKit continues to evolve with each iOS development update, with Apple consistently improving its performance, features, and capabilities. This constant evolution is opening up new possibilities for developers to create immersive and engaging experiences.

Core ML: Unleashing the Power of Machine Learning

Now, let's talk about Core ML! Core ML is the framework that allows iOS developers to bring the power of machine learning to their apps. Core ML lets you integrate pre-trained machine learning models into your apps or even train your models directly within Xcode, allowing you to create apps that are smarter, more intuitive, and personalized. One of the core benefits of Core ML is its ease of use. Apple has made it very simple for developers to integrate machine learning models into their apps. You can easily import pre-trained models from various sources or use Apple's tools to convert existing models. Once the model is integrated, you can use Core ML's APIs to make predictions and process data. Core ML also offers optimized performance. Apple has optimized Core ML to run efficiently on Apple devices, taking advantage of the device's hardware acceleration capabilities. This means that your machine-learning models will run faster and consume less power. Core ML also supports a wide range of machine learning models, including those for image recognition, natural language processing, and more. This gives you a lot of flexibility in creating different types of apps. The latest updates to Core ML provide developers with new tools and capabilities. Apple continues to improve Core ML's support for different model types, making it easier to integrate even more advanced machine-learning capabilities. Core ML is a transformative technology that allows developers to create more intelligent and engaging apps. By leveraging Core ML, developers can provide users with features such as smart image recognition, natural language processing, and personalized recommendations. The potential is enormous, and Core ML is constantly evolving, making it an exciting area of focus for iOS development.

Key Resources for iOS Developers

Alright, let's equip you with some resources! There's a ton of information out there, but knowing where to look can save you time. First off, the Apple Developer website. This is the motherlode of information, and it's essential for anyone involved in iOS development. You'll find documentation, tutorials, sample code, and the latest news on all things Apple. Next, Apple's documentation is critical. This provides the most comprehensive and authoritative information on the iOS SDK, including detailed explanations of APIs, frameworks, and tools. Then, Stack Overflow is super important. Stack Overflow is the go-to resource for getting answers to your coding questions and helping others with theirs. The iOS development community on Stack Overflow is incredibly active, and you can usually find solutions to common problems. Following this, blogs and online tutorials are a big help. Many blogs and websites provide tutorials, articles, and insights on various aspects of iOS development. These resources can help you stay up-to-date with the latest trends, best practices, and new technologies. Also, the Swift.org website is the main source of information on the Swift programming language, which is used for most iOS apps. You can find documentation, language references, and community resources. Also, you can find the WWDC videos. WWDC (Worldwide Developers Conference) is a fantastic source of information, where Apple announces new technologies and provides insights into the future of iOS. Watching the WWDC videos is essential to keep up with the latest advancements. These resources will help you navigate the ever-evolving world of iOS development and stay ahead of the curve.
